Climate and Average Weather Year Round in Paris France. In Paris, the summers are short, comfortable, and partly cloudy and the winters are very cold, windy, and mostly cloudy. Over the course of the year, the temperature typically varies from 35°F to 78°F and is rarely below 25°F or above 88°F.

Beside above, is Paris always cold? Paris experiences mostly mild weather across four distinct seasons. Average daily highs range from 46°F (8°C) in the winter to 77°F (25°C) at the height of summer. Extreme cold or heat are pretty rare, but rain is not. In Paris, light showers can come and go quickly throughout the day.

France generally enjoys cool winters and mild summers except along the Mediterranean where mild winters and hot summers are the norm. Average winter temperatures range from 32° F to 46° F and average summer temperatures from 61° F to 75° F. For the most warmth and sunshine go to the south of the country.

People ask also, which part of France has the best climate? The warmest place in France is the French Riviera coast in Southern France. With average summer temperatures well above 30oC (80oF) and long dry summers and warm springs and autumns and mild winters, the South of France is the place to experience the best climate in France throughout the year.

What is winter like in Paris France?

Paris Weather in Winter Temperatures tend to stay cold throughout most of the winter but rarely dip below freezing. Average highs linger at around 46 degrees Fahrenheit and average lows remain around 36 to 37 degrees Fahrenheit from December, January, and February, with slight variations on overcast or sunny days.

How hot does Paris get in the summer?

Summer in Paris From June to September, the average temperatures are minimum 55°F (13°C) and maximum 77°F (25°C). Sometimes it can get up to 86°F (30°C), but rarely. However, the heat in this city is humid and it can be oppressive to wander the streets of Paris during the hottest days.

What is France’s summer like?

Summer in France With the exception of the western coastal areas—which tend to be more temperate—summer conditions in France are typically warm or hot. Average temperatures range from about 60 to 80 F in Paris, while in Nice and on the south coast they range from around 80 to 90 F.

What is the coldest city in France?

Just a 20-minute drive from Chappelle-des-Bois is Mouthe, officially the coldest place in France… ever! Known as “Little Siberia” (La Petite Sibérie) to the locals, it registered a truly apocalyptic -41 degrees on that fateful January 17, 1985. Is Paris dry or humid?

Paris has some very humid months, with other comfortably humid months. The least humid month is April (50.8% relative humidity), and the most humid month is November (76.6%). Wind in Paris is usually calm. The windiest month is March, followed by December and February.
